And to what benefit? This is the point of the article. Sign in for apple is extra work and extra complexity for no benefit (to the developer, at least). It's an immature project and the fact that Apple is putting in the bare minimum effort into the docs does not encourage me to adopt this feature.
Google, in comparison, has a working sample project and step by step guide for implementing Google sign in on iOS[1]. Google sign in is just as much a "curl request" as apple sign in, but they put in the effort to give a high quality, well integrated, and native example.
Apple can't be bothered, which discourages people like OP from adopting the feature.
